I had a suspicion when I saw it that Garrison was trying for Laocoön, but it's a pretty lovely rendition of a really fabulous statue. Laocoön deserves better.

But the thing about Laocoön is that we don't really know why he was being tortured by serpents. Virgil, in the Aenid, says Laocoön was a Trojan priest who tried to reveal the ruse of the Trojan Horse, but was punished for daring to strike what was meant to be a divine object, even if he was ultimately correct. I'm sure Garrison likes this interpretation.

But the story of Laocoön is older, from a play by Sophocles centuries earlier, but the actual play is lost. Enough people wrote about the play that we know this version is that Laocoön was supposed to be celibate but married and had children, and this was his divine punishment. Other versions say that Laocoön's crime was not the marriage itself, but rather loving his wife in the temple. Either way, Poseidon sent snakes to murder him and/or his sons, and their deaths were taken as divine proof that the Trojan Horse really was holy and should definitely be hauled into the city, because Laocoön was the one doubting it.

So, as usual, Garrison is bad at metaphor.
